finalists for the North Carolina Center for the Advancement of Teaching (NCCAT) 2025 Burroughs Wellcome Fund NC Beginning Teacher of the Year Award, including Dobson Elementary School's own Sydney McKeaver Coe!
This prestigious recognition highlights her dedication and impact as an educator. One finalist will be honored as the 2025 NC Beginning Teacher of the Year after a comprehensive selection process by a panel of judges.
As part of this achievement, finalists will attend a professional development week at the Truist Leadership Institute in Greensboro, N.C., from March 24–28, 2025. The winner will be announced during a special ceremony on March 27, 2025, at the Elliott University Center auditorium at the University of North Carolina Greensboro.

A Book-A-Thon is designed to reinforce good reading habits while raising funds to support the Literacy Committee.
The Book-A-Thon will start on December 21st and end on January 12th.
We encourage students to get pledges from family and neighbors.
PRIZE LIST:
If you raise $10.00-Cookie from the cafeteria.
If you are the Top Grade Level $ Raiser-$10.00 Scholastic coupon for the book fair.
If you are the top $ Collector in the school-Kindle
NEED TO KNOW INFORMATION:
Step One: Gather pledges.
Sponsors may pledge an amount for each page (ex. $0.10 per page) OR a flat amount. (ex. $5.00)
Step Two: Read, read, read!
After the Book-a-Thon starts, you’ll need to read!
Record your reading minutes on the Reading Tracker.
Be sure to have your parent’s or teacher’s initial that you read during that time.
Step Three: Collect money.
Step Four: Turn in the envelope to Mrs. Edwards on Tuesday, January 14th.
